Output 3fc74382fa6de56cb53bd58f289554f3d93aa31978ba5a15777a29e3fafbe1b9:1

value
1031706
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95c6ac0027afbea2be3a283f00ca5d1077c0949c OP_EQUALVERIFY OP_CHECKSIG
address
1EewgYiLhvUvPEeDrBePKvLxji2kBB9gYb
transaction
3fc74382fa6de56cb53bd58f289554f3d93aa31978ba5a15777a29e3fafbe1b9
confirmations
284821
spent
true